Award to Whanganui iwi business
A recycling joint venture between iwi group Te Runanga o Tupoho and the Whanganui District Council has won the Community Innovation section of this year’s Sustainable Business Network Awards.
Judges said the Whanganui Resource Recovery Centre was getting some incredible reuse and conversion statistics.
As well as recycling a wide range of waste, it was providing education and community facilities at its base in the former town prison.
Manager Ramari Te Uamairangi says the iwi saw it as an opportunity to be involved in a progressive business that benefits not just its own people but the people of Whanganui, while looking after papatuanuku.
